Episode description

John Lenczowski is the founder, chancellor, and president emeritus of The Institute of World Politics, a District of Columbia-based graduate school that specializes in the instruments of statecraft and national security. He was the principal Soviet affairs advisor to President Ronald Reagan.

What are the Chinese Communist Party’s primary tools of strategic deception? And why don’t more people know about them?

“The Chinese have 600 front organizations operating in the United States today trying to influence all sorts of segments of our society,” he says.

In this episode, we sit down to discuss America’s failure to understand the nature of the communist China threat, and what should be done to counter it.

“The problem is that our foreign policy establishment is principally concerned with creating what I consider to be the false atmospherics of peace, rather than genuine peace,” he says.
